[原创]PHPCMS遭遇会员投稿审核无效的解决方法


Posted in PHP onJanuary 11, 2017

今天接到主编那边的反馈,说本站的会员投稿平台,后台无法审核文章了,赶紧看看吧

本来想偷个懒,去度娘那里搜搜,看有相同情况的解决方案没,结果大失所望,虽然也有几个类似的情况,要么没解决,要么就是原因跟本站不同。

得了,毛主席他老人家教导我们,自己动手,丰衣足食!

先找到审核的相关程序页

 /phpcms/modules/content/content.php中的pass()方法,检查了下,并无被修改的现象

去审核页面按F12调试,控制台也无报错情况

真是奇了怪了,

查看下源码,发现了这段

<script type="text/javascript">art.dialog({lock:false,title:'管理操作',mouse:true, id:'content_m', content:'<span id=cloading ><a href=\'javascript:ajax_manage(1)\'>通过审核</a> | <a href=\'javascript:ajax_manage(2)\'>退稿</a> | <a href=\'javascript:ajax_manage(3)\'>删除</a></span>',left:'100%',top:'100%',width:200,height:50,drag:true, fixed:true});
		function ajax_manage(type) {
			if(type==1) {
				$.get('?m=content&c=content&a=pass&ajax_preview=1&catid=6&steps=1&id=533&pc_hash=4KwIwD');
			} else if(type==2) {
				$.get('?m=content&c=content&a=pass&ajax_preview=1&reject=1&catid=6&steps=1&id=533&pc_hash=4KwIwD');
			} else if(type==3) {
				$.get('?m=content&c=content&a=delete&ajax_preview=1&dosubmit=1&catid=6&steps=1&id=533&pc_hash=4KwIwD');
			}
			$('#cloading').html('<font color=red>操作成功!<span id="secondid">2</span>秒后自动离开...</font>');
			setInterval('set_time()', 1000);
			setInterval('window.close()', 2000);
		}
		function set_time() {
			$('#secondid').html(1);
		}
		</script>

怪不得不报错。。。

好了,我们把审核链接单独拿出来 http://yourdomain.com/index.php?m=content&c=content&a=pass&ajax_preview=1&catid=6&steps=1&id=533&pc_hash=4KwIwD

放到浏览器地址栏执行一下

果然,有了错误提示了

MySQL Error : Table '.\***\v9_search' is marked as crashed and should be repaired 
MySQL Errno : 145 
Message : Table '.\***\v9_search' is marked as crashed and should be repaired

原来是search表需要修复下。。。那就修修吧,修完之后,果然审核功能正常了

PHP 相关文章推荐
用PHP编程开发“虚拟域名”系统
Oct 09 PHP
php合并数组array_merge函数运算符加号与的区别
Oct 31 PHP
php str_pad() 将字符串填充成指定长度的字符串
Feb 23 PHP
PHP在线生成二维码代码(google api)
Jun 03 PHP
thinkphp3查询mssql数据库乱码解决方法分享
Feb 11 PHP
PHP捕获Fatal error错误的方法
Jun 11 PHP
Yii实现的多级联动下拉菜单
Jul 13 PHP
php插件Xajax使用方法详解
Aug 31 PHP
PHP使用Nginx实现反向代理
Sep 20 PHP
PHP实现防止表单重复提交功能【基于token验证】
May 24 PHP
在Laravel5.6中使用Swoole的协程数据库查询
Jun 15 PHP
php面向对象重点知识分享
Sep 27 PHP
YII2 实现多语言配置的方法分享
Jan 11 #PHP
laravel5.2实现区分前后台用户登录的方法
Jan 11 #PHP
PHP全功能无变形图片裁剪操作类与用法示例
Jan 10 #PHP
php实现36进制与10进制转换功能示例
Jan 10 #PHP
php获取当前url地址的方法小结
Jan 10 #PHP
PHP实现接收二进制流转换成图片的方法
Jan 10 #PHP
ThinkPHP 模板substr的截取字符串函数详解
Jan 09 #PHP
You might like
PHP autoload与spl_autoload自动加载机制的深入理解
2013/06/05 PHP
探讨Hessian在PHP中的使用分析
2013/06/13 PHP
phpmailer发送邮件之后,返回收件人是否阅读了邮件的方法
2014/07/19 PHP
PHP图片自动裁切应付不同尺寸的显示
2014/10/16 PHP
Yii使用smsto短信接口的函数demo示例
2016/07/13 PHP
php基于SQLite实现的分页功能示例
2017/06/21 PHP
PHPMAILER实现PHP发邮件功能
2018/04/18 PHP
document.compatMode介绍
2009/05/21 Javascript
实现变速回到顶部的JavaScript代码
2011/05/09 Javascript
33个优秀的 jQuery 图片展示插件分享
2012/03/14 Javascript
js借助ActiveXObject实现创建文件
2013/09/29 Javascript
jquery获取radio值实例
2014/10/16 Javascript
个人网站留言页面(前端jQuery编写、后台php读写MySQL)
2016/05/03 Javascript
js多功能分页组件layPage使用方法详解
2016/05/19 Javascript
判断输入的字符串是否是日期格式的简单方法
2016/07/11 Javascript
js 定义对象数组(结合)多维数组方法
2016/07/27 Javascript
微信小程序自定义tab实现多层tab嵌套功能
2018/06/15 Javascript
详解auto-vue-file:一个自动创建vue组件的包
2019/04/26 Javascript
js设置默认时间跨度过程详解
2019/07/17 Javascript
vue 获取视频时长的实例代码
2019/08/20 Javascript
JS函数进阶之继承用法实例分析
2020/01/15 Javascript
python3+opencv3识别图片中的物体并截取的方法
2018/12/05 Python
pyqt5移动鼠标显示坐标的方法
2019/06/21 Python
在pandas中遍历DataFrame行的实现方法
2019/10/23 Python
Python Numpy 控制台完全输出ndarray的实现
2020/02/19 Python
django 利用Q对象与F对象进行查询的实现
2020/05/15 Python
Python爬虫HTPP请求方法有哪些
2020/06/03 Python
法雷奥SQA(electric)面试问题
2016/01/23 面试题
自荐信不宜过于夸大
2013/11/06 职场文书
化学教育专业求职信
2014/07/08 职场文书
企业介绍信范文
2015/01/30 职场文书
2015年人事工作总结范文
2015/04/09 职场文书
Nginx快速入门教程
2021/03/31 Servers
Python django中如何使用restful框架
2021/06/23 Python
「月刊Action」2022年5月号封面公开
2022/03/21 日漫
JavaScript原型链中函数和对象的理解
2022/06/16 Javascript